---- Psalm 40:1 ---- written 1000-900 B.C.----
Psa 40:1 Mwen te mete tout espwa m' nan Seyè a. Li te panche zòrèy li bò kote m', li te tande m' lè m' t'ap rele.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:1 I waited patiently for the Lord; And He inclined to me and heard my cry.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:2----
Psa 40:2 Li rale m' soti nan twou kote m' t'ap peri a, nan gwo ma labou a. Li mete m' sou gwo wòch la, li fè m' kanpe dwat ankò.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:2 He brought me up out of the pit of destruction, out of the miry clay, And He set my feet upon a rock making my footsteps firm.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:3----
Psa 40:3 Li mete yon chante tou nèf nan bouch mwen, yon chante pou m' fè lwanj Bondye nou an. Anpil moun, lè yo wè sa, yo pral pè, y'a mete konfyans yo nan Seyè a.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:3 He put a new song in my mouth, a song of praise to our God; Many will see and fear And will trust in the Lord.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:4----
Psa 40:4 Ala bon sa bon pou moun ki mete konfyans yo nan Seyè a, pou moun ki p'ap swiv ni moun k'ap fè awogans yo ni moun k'ap bay manti yo!(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:4 How blessed is the man who has made the Lord his trust, And has not turned to the proud, nor to those who lapse into falsehood.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:5----
Psa 40:5 Seyè, Bondye mwen, ou te fè anpil bèl mèvèy pou nou, ou te fè anpil lide pou nou. Pa gen tankou ou, Seyè! Mwen ta renmen fè moun konnen yo, mwen ta renmen pale sou yo. Men, yo sitèlman anpil, mwen pa ka rakonte yo.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:5 Many, O Lord my God, are the wonders which You have done, And Your thoughts toward us; There is none to compare with You. If I would declare and speak of them, They would be too numerous to count.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:6----
Psa 40:6 Ou pa bezwen yo fè okenn ofrann bèt pou boule pou ou, ni pou yo fè ou kado anyen. Men, ou louvri zòrèy mwen yo. Ou pa mande pou yo boule okenn vyann bèt pou ou, ni pou yo touye bèt pou wete peche.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:6 Sacrifice and meal offering You have not desired; My ears You have opened; Burnt offering and sin offering You have not required.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:7----
Psa 40:7 Lè sa a mwen di: -Men mwen, mwen vini, jan sa ekri sou mwen nan liv la.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:7 Then I said, "Behold, I come; In the scroll of the book it is written of me.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:8----
Psa 40:8 Bondye mwen, mwen pran plezi m' nan fè sa ou vle m' fè. Wi, mwen kenbe lalwa ou nan fon kè m'(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:8 I delight to do Your will, O my God; Your Law is within my heart."(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:9----
Psa 40:9 Seyè, lè tout pèp Bondye a te reyini, mwen te fè yo konnen jan ou fè nou gras. Wi, ou konn sa, mwen p'ap rete ak bouch mwen fèmen.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:9 I have proclaimed glad tidings of righteousness in the great congregation; Behold, I will not restrain my lips, O Lord, You know.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:10----
Psa 40:10 Mwen pa t' manke pa di jan ou fè nou gras, jan ou bay moun sekou. Nan mitan tout pèp Bondye a, lè yo reyini, mwen pa t' manke pa di jan ou renmen nou, jan ou toujou kenbe pawòl ou.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:10 I have not hidden Your righteousness within my heart; I have spoken of Your faithfulness and Your salvation; I have not concealed Your lovingkindness and Your truth from the great congregation.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:11----
Psa 40:11 Seyè, ou pa janm sispann gen pitye pou mwen. W'ap toujou pwoteje m', paske ou renmen m'. Ou p'ap janm lage m'.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:11 You, O Lord, will not withhold Your compassion from me; Your lovingkindness and Your truth will continually preserve me.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:12----
Psa 40:12 Kote m' vire, malè tonbe sou mwen. Mwen pa ka konte yo. Peche m' yo twòp pou mwen. Mwen pa k'ap sipòte yo. Yo pi plis pase cheve nan tèt mwen. Mwen pèdi tout kouraj mwen.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:12 For evils beyond number have surrounded me; My iniquities have overtaken me, so that I am not able to see; They are more numerous than the hairs of my head, And my heart has failed me.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:13----
Psa 40:13 Seyè, tanpri, delivre m' non! Prese vin pote m' sekou, Seyè.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:13 Be pleased, O Lord, to deliver me; Make haste, O Lord, to help me.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:14----
Psa 40:14 Moun k'ap chache touye m' yo, se pou yo tout wont, se pou yo pa ka leve tèt yo. Moun ki anvi wè malè rive mwen, se pou yo renka kò yo, se pou yo wont.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:14 Let those be ashamed and humiliated together Who seek my life to destroy it; Let those be turned back and dishonored Who delight in my hurt.(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:15----
Psa 40:15 Moun k'ap lonje dwèt sou mwen yo, se pou sezisman pran yo tèlman yo wont.(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:15 Let those be appalled because of their shame Who say to me, "Aha, aha!"(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:16----
Psa 40:16 Men, tout moun ki vin jwenn ou, se pou yo kontan, se pou yo fè fèt. Tout moun ki renmen jan ou delivre yo a, se tout tan pou yo di: -Seyè a gen gwo pouvwa!(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:16 Let all who seek You rejoice and be glad in You; Let those who love Your salvation say continually, "The Lord be magnified!"(NASB-1995)

================================================================================
---- Psalm 40:17----
Psa 40:17 Pou mwen menm, se yon pòv malere san sekou mwen ye. Men ou menm ki mèt mwen, pa bliye m'. Se ou ki tout sekou mwen, se ou ki tout delivrans mwen. Bondye mwen, pa mize!(Creole-HT)
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Psa 40:17 Since I am afflicted and needy, Let the Lord be mindful of me. You are my help and my deliverer; Do not delay, O my God.(NASB-1995)
